Explore the complexities of confidential attestation in this 41-minute conference talk by IBM experts Tobin Feldman-FItzthum and Dov Murik. Delve into the overloaded concept of attestation amidst the rise of confidential computing technologies. Compare and contrast the properties and flows of SEV-ES, SEV-SNP, and Intel TDX attestations with traditional techniques. Examine strategies for reconciling differences and unifying confidential attestation, including the implementation of secure vTPMs backed by hardware root of trust. Investigate the Confidential Containers Attestation Agent as an alternative approach for unified attestation. Analyze related proposals from the Libvirt community and draw conclusions on the most sensible areas for standardization in this Linux Foundation presentation.
